Man, 35, Killed After Car Crashes Into Tree: Batavia Police
The single-car crash happened near the intersection of Fabyan Parkway and Route 31 in Batavia.
BATAVIA, IL — A Batavia man was killed Tuesday night after his car struck a tree near Fabyan Parkway and Route 31, according to police.
Batavia police identified the victim as Robert Foley, 35.
Officers were dispatched at 9:43 p.m. for the single-car crash. A preliminary investigation determined the man was driving eastbound on West Fabyan Parkway, approaching Route 31, when the car left the road and hit a tree, officials said.

First responders extracted the man from the car and performed life-saving measures before he was transported to Northwestern Medicine Delnor Hospital, where he was pronounced dead, according to a Wednesday morning news release.
Police continue to investigate the crash.
